问题标签 [blueimp]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
861 浏览

javascript - 上一个文件进度达到 100% 与停止/完成事件之间的差距大吗?

我正在使用blueimp 文件上传插件来实现一些文件上传功能,我注意到在我的最后一个文件进度条达到 100% 和停止和完成事件触发之间可能会有很大的时间间隔。我有以下代码:

有谁知道为什么会发生这种情况?我怎样才能做到这一点,以便在调用完成/停止时考虑进度条?

0 投票
7 回答
9080 浏览

jquery-ui - jquery文件上传 - 如何覆盖文件不重命名

我正在努力更新 Jquery 文件上传插件,因此当您上传文件时,它只会覆盖具有相同名称的现有文件,而不是使用 upcount 重命名它。

我已应用此链接中涵盖的更改:https ://github.com/blueimp/jQuery-File-Upload/issues/1965

但我似乎无法覆盖这个插件来让它工作?

这里有一个尚未回答的现有问题:jQuery File Upload by bluimp,如何替换而不是重命名

对此的任何指导将不胜感激。

0 投票
2 回答
21895 浏览

jquery - $('#fileupload').fileupload 函数没有调用

我正在配置 blueimp 以在点击发布按钮时上传图片。我的问题是它没有调用该$('#fileupload').fileupload函数。我已包含以下 javascript 文件。以下是我的代码,请看看是什么问题。

0 投票
1 回答
5714 浏览

ajax - Blueimp jQuery 文件上传和 symfony2:自定义上传处理程序的问题

我正在使用 Symfony2,我想使用 BlueImp 插件,基本设置

实际上,我有一个表格,您可以在其中加载 3 张图片和一首歌曲(用于艺术家注册)。

首先,我尝试为一张图片实现插件。但是当我在我的输入“图片 1”中选择一个文件时,什么也没有发生。有什么问题?

这是上传处理程序(url {{path('MyBundle_ajax_upload_picture') }} 的操作:

0 投票
1 回答
1119 浏览

php - 如何通过 jQuery (blueimp / jQuery-File-Upload) 动态设置上传目的地

这是一个关于 blueimp 的 jQuery-File-Upload 的问题,可以在这里找到:

blueimp 的 jQuery 文件上传

有谁知道如何通过 jQuery 设置上传目标 url 或文件夹?使用下载的 PHP 示例,您能提供一个示例吗?

非常感谢!

0 投票
0 回答
135 浏览

javascript - IE8 使我的 xml 损坏

我正在使用 blueimp fileupload 将多个文件上传到我的服务器。在“完成”回调中,我捕获了我的 xml 结果,但在 IE8 中都搞砸了。这是结果:

如您所见,它在xml节点之间添加了“-”符号,并且在chrome或firefox中没有。有谁可以告诉我为什么会这样?这是 IE 的已知问题吗?

0 投票
2 回答
5499 浏览

jquery - blueimp jQuery-File-Upload 没有 ajax

我真的很喜欢客户端处理选择文件并具有取消或删除选项的预览。

但是我想用表单上传页面,我不需要使用 ajax。我一直在摆弄所有选项,但无论如何我都找不到要发布以同步选择的文件的形式。

是否可以让 data.files 与表单一起发布?

0 投票
1 回答
5541 浏览

jquery - BlueImp Plugin jQuery File Upload:如何使用 fileInput 选项以便 fileupload() 可以绑定新的动态添加的输入?

我使用 BlueImp 插件上传我的文件。用户单击“添加文件”时会动态添加新的文件输入。
然后,当用户上传文件时,它会通过 AJAX 存储在我的 web 文件夹中。

我的第一个想法是在生成的 id 上调用 fileupload 方法(例如:$('#files_0').fileupload( { //ajax processing } );
但是这个解决方案不起作用,因为加载页面时输入不存在。

所以我需要类似的东西,$('#files_0').live('click, function ({ fileupload( { //ajax processing } ) )};但这也不起作用。

所以我检查了文档和论坛,发现这是使用该fileInput选项的解决方案。所以在这里我做了什么,但这不起作用..任何帮助都会很棒!

0 投票
0 回答
838 浏览

php - 跨域图片上传的 Access-Control-Allow-Origin 错误


****用例:****我正在使用jquery/ajax 上传器进行跨域图像上传。我已经设置了一个使用 PHP 跨域上传图像的演示。

****问题:****当我将图像从一个域上传到另一个域时(我在其他域上有包含 PHP 文件的服务器文件夹)原始图像被上传但是,缩略图没有上传(或没有创建) 我收到 Access-Control-Allow-Origin 的错误

我已将 UploadHandler.php 中的Access-Control-Allow-Origin参数保留为'*' 。我的GET 请求没有给我错误,但是当我上传时,我看到一个选项请求(正常工作)和一个 POST 请求产生错误。

Reasearch/Study:我经历了几个问题并试图解决这个插件的 GIT 问题,他们建议在 Access-Control-Allow-Origin 参数中添加“*”应该像这样(php 文件来连同插件)。其余设置在 js 文件中保持为默认值。

请提出在这种情况下有帮助的任何解决方案。

附上一张图片以清除错误!请提出任何解决方案。 在此处输入图像描述

![失败选项请求的标题][3]

更新:

这是我用来创建上传图像的裁剪形式的数组。当我不传递数组时,我得到成功的标题作为响应,但是当我这样做时,我得到了Access-Control-Origin-Error。当我检查服务器日志时,我得到一个Headers already sent error。(我使用的 PHP 脚本与插件相同。在server/php文件夹中存在)

0 投票
1 回答
1060 浏览

node.js - 启动 node.js 服务

我正在尝试按照此处找到的 node.js 服务 blueimp-file-upload 的设置说明进行操作:

https://github.com/blueimp/jQuery-File-Upload/wiki/Setup

具体来说,我正在使用 Node.js 使用 jQuery File Upload (UI version)下的这些步骤:

您可以通过 npm 在您的服务器上安装示例 Node.js 上传服务:

npm install blueimp-file-upload-node

您可以通过运行以下命令来启动服务:

./node_modules/blueimp-file-upload-node/server.js

我已经完成了第一步(安装npm),但是我不明白运行“./node_modules/...”命令是什么意思。它在 Windows 的命令提示符和特定于 Node.js 的命令提示符中不被视为有效语法,即使以 npm 为前缀也是如此。